Forty-four workers were evacuated from a natural gas rig in the Gulf on Mexico Tuesday following a blowout on the platform, U.S. Coast Guard Lt. Scott Talbot said.
The incident took place as the Hercules 265 platform hit an unexpected gas pocket as crew members were preparing the well for production.
No injuries were reported after the collision.
Talbot said that there was no visible sheen on the water's surface. He did not specify when the gas would be shut off.
The affected rig is leased by Walter Oil & Gas Corporation.
